Graphene is a waste of money, a very senior British professor told me last year during a conversation about government funding for science.

It might be useful to a few applications, he complained, but graphene will never be revolutionary: the technology is too limited - it is interesting but not a game changer.

We were talking a few months after the Chancellor George Osborne had allocated £50m to graphene research.

The year before, Andre Geim and Konstantin Novoselov of Manchester University had won the Nobel Prize for Physics for their pioneering work on the "miracle material" and the funding was a vote of faith in an exciting new area of research. Another £11m followed just after Christmas.

Graphene is the name given to a novel substance composed of a single layer of carbon atoms, extracted from graphite, with astonishing properties: the stuff is stronger than diamond, more conductive than copper and more flexible than rubber.
